Betty White on 'Tonight': Dirty jokes, Jay-Z and 'Hot in Cleveland'
Betty White is all the rage right now and Wednesday, May 12 Jay Leno welcomed her to "The Tonight Show." Much hilarity ensued.Betty White laughs at her recent exposure, "You should be throwing rocks at me, you've had such an overdose."
Her retelling of the "Saturday Night Live" experience is hilarious -- Jay even gets a nice crack in about how she got the gig at "SNL." Also, apparently musical guest Jay-Z got a little handsy. "He didn't get fresh, he just got desperate, I guess. He walked by and, ya know, patted me. Not on the shoulder."
In the second video, there is a clip of Betty White and Bea Arthur dancing and singing to "42nd Street" on the old Dinah Shore show. It is delightful. There's also a clip from her new show "Hot in Cleveland," which premieres on TV Land in June.
